According to its site, NuCalm is "the world's only trademarked neuroscience technology clinically proven to solve tension and improve sleep quality without drugs." It integrates a neuroacoustic software app utilized for 20- to 120-minute increments, an eye mask and the aforementioned processing discs, and in practice involves listening to ambient, cinematic sounds (similar to this) with your eyes closed and a sticker label stuck to your inner arm.

Each of the components are designed to trigger the body's parasympathetic nerve system, which helps with recovery and relaxation - how to reduce stress in your life. The disc is designed to release gamma-aminobutyric acid, a neurotransmitter that inhibits cortisol and adrenaline. With this and the app, NuCalm halts your body's tension reaction and therefore the mental and physical toll stress can take on the body.

It's really the main inhibitory neurotransmitter system in brain circuits. Gamma-Aminobutyric Acid is a relaxation neurotransmitter that the body produces naturally when we're preparing to sleep, so the technique of using GABA supplements to indicate the brain that it's time to relax makes good sense - how to de stress and reduce anxiety. What's not completely clear, however, is how reliable oral GABA supplements are in triggering those advantages.

While some studies have revealed that GABA can cross the blood-brain barrier, others have revealed the opposite, suggesting a possible placebo result behind viewed advantages of the supplements. Researchers agree that more research study is needed to determine how advantageous GABA supplements genuinely are. In 2017, Gwyneth Paltrow's GOOP promoted a $120 brand of bio-frequency stickers, causing a brief viral minute for the tech. to reduce stress. Sadly for proponents of the devices, the response wasn't terrific, with Mark Shelhamer, former chief researcher at NASA's human research study division, notably decrying the GOOP-endorsed item as "snake oil." Although the NuCalm website describes that "each disc holds the electromagnetic frequency patterns of GABA and its precursors to deliver a pure biosignal to your body," it's not clear precisely how placing the sticker on your wrist triggers that delivery.
